Core Viewpoint - Intel has officially launched its third-generation Core Ultra processors, marking a significant advancement in AI PC technology and a return to leadership in semiconductor manufacturing with the introduction of the Intel 18A process node [1][5][12]. Group 1: Processor Features and Innovations - The third-generation Intel Core Ultra processors are expected to be the broadest AI PC platform ever created by Intel [4]. - The Intel 18A process introduces two key technologies: RibbonFET, which enhances transistor control and reduces leakage, and PowerVia, which moves power delivery to the back of the chip to minimize signal interference [12][13][14]. - The Intel 18A process results in over 15% performance improvement at the same power level, or a 25% reduction in power consumption for the same performance, with a 30% increase in transistor density [16]. Group 2: Performance Metrics - The flagship models, Core Ultra X9 and X7, feature up to 16 CPU cores, including new performance and efficiency cores, and 12 X cores [19]. - The integrated Intel Arc GPU significantly boosts graphics performance, with a 77% increase in average frame rates across 45 games at 1080p high settings compared to the previous generation [21]. - Multi-threaded performance has improved by 60% based on Cinebench 2024 tests, enhancing productivity tasks such as video editing and coding [25][27]. - The processors offer an impressive battery life of up to 27 hours, allowing for extended use without needing a charger [29][30]. Group 3: AI and Edge Computing - The flagship model's NPU performance reaches 50 TOPS, showcasing significant capabilities in AI applications such as large language models and video analysis [35]. - The third-generation Core Ultra processors are designed for both consumer PCs and edge computing applications, supporting a wide range of devices from smart robots to medical equipment [41]. - This marks the first time Intel has tested and certified processors for embedded and industrial edge scenarios, indicating a strategic expansion into these markets [40]. Group 4: Market Availability - The first batch of consumer laptops featuring the third-generation Core Ultra processors will be available for pre-order on January 6, with a global release on January 27 [43]. - Over 200 PC products are already in development, covering a wide range of applications from consumer PCs to edge computing [44]. Summary of Intel's CES 2026 Conference Call Company Overview - **Company**: Intel Corporation (NasdaqGS: INTC) - **Event**: CES 2026 Conference Call - **Date**: January 5, 2026 Key Industry Insights - **AI Integration**: AI is transforming workflows across industries, and Intel aims to make AI intelligence accessible and efficient [1][2] - **Strategic Inflection Point**: The industry is at a critical juncture, with Intel delivering leadership products that integrate compute, graphics, and AI [5] Core Product Developments - **Core Ultra Series 3**: - First processor built with 18A technology, offering significant improvements in performance and efficiency [9][10] - Delivers 60% more performance than the previous Lunar Lake Series 2, with a focus on power efficiency [13] - Features new E-cores, P-cores, and a GPU with built-in ray tracing capabilities [9][10] - Achieves up to 15% better performance per watt and over 30% better chip density due to advanced technologies like RibbonFET and PowerVia [6] Graphics Advancements - **Intel Arc B390 Graphics**: - Next-generation integrated GPU with 50% more graphics cores and 70% more gaming performance compared to previous models [17] - Capable of delivering 120 GPU TOPS and significantly improved frame rates compared to competitors [17][19] - Introduces AI-based multi-frame generation, enhancing gaming experiences [19] AI and Software Ecosystem - **AI PC Footprint**: Intel has established the largest AI PC footprint in the industry, driving software innovation [33] - **Local AI Execution**: Emphasizes the importance of local AI processing for performance, privacy, and cost efficiency [40][44] - **Collaboration with Software Partners**: Intel supports hundreds of ISVs to optimize AI applications for its hardware [36][37] Market Position and Future Outlook - **Edge Computing**: Intel is accelerating the launch of 18A products for edge markets, aligning with the PC launch to meet growing demand [61] - **Broad Adoption**: Series 3 is expected to be the most widely adopted AI PC platform, with over 200 designs planned [63] - **Strategic Goals**: Intel aims to redefine the intelligence PC stack, combining hardware, software, and infrastructure for enhanced client devices [38] Additional Noteworthy Points - **Investment in R&D**: Over the last five years, Intel has heavily invested in capital, R&D, and new manufacturing capabilities [6] - **Performance Metrics**: Series 3 processors are designed to support a wide range of applications, with significant improvements in battery life and power efficiency [12][13] - **Future Gaming Platforms**: Intel plans to launch a handheld gaming platform based on Panther Lake technology [32] This summary encapsulates the critical points discussed during Intel's CES 2026 conference call, highlighting the company's advancements in AI, graphics, and overall market strategy.
